Control system keeps watch over
viscosity
A new PLC-based viscosity control system that controls up to 10 stations, provides three trend plots for each and allows adjustment during operation is being introduced by Norcross Corporation.

Featuring trend plot software, this control system displays trend data for each station in real time, provides data logging for one hour up to seven days, and permits setpoint and other viscosity parameter adjustments on-the-fly.
Capable of displaying setpoint, actual viscosity and automatic/manual mode for each trend plot, the Norcross VISC6000 viscosity control system can be equipped with pH and temperature control options.
Compatible with all Norcross equipment, it can be easily retrofitted to existing applications which include inks, adhesives, chemicals, coatings, lacquers, and more.
